Abstract

This article is devoted to studying the impact of social technologies on employment generation and human capital development in the service economy. During the research, digital labor platforms, remote employment systems, professional skills development programs, and their impact on youth employment were analyzed. The article examines the growth in the volume of information technology services exports, the dynamics of changes in the employment rate, and the effectiveness of state programs for digital skills development. Based on the research results, practical recommendations aimed at expanding employment and improving the quality of human capital in the service sector through social technologies were developed.
